I like to get remnants from Walmart and cover little notebooks and notepads and keep them in my purse. I love fabric remnants, and I have this piece of fabric (in the photo below), which has covered a simple notepad that I keep in my purse.
I either use duct tape to match the fabric or a glue gun. I could make it with lace and such, but I mainly use them for a book cover. I am going to cover a puzzle book I am working on now. It makes the paper notepads and other books stay together and not get torn. I have matching rubber bands of different colors that I like to use with these little notepads.
